Members of the Army Wives Association (AWA) has celebrated their Annual Thanksgiving Service at the Garrison Methodist Presbyterian Church Auditorium in Burma Camp on Saturday, 6 December 2025.
Delivering the sermon on the theme ‘The Benefits of Thanksgiving using the 3P's in our Daily Life Activities’, Lieutenant Commander (Lt Cdr) Peter Amegashie from the Medical Directorate at the General Headquarters, briefed the congregation on the 3P's; Divine Placement, Divine Planting and Divine Protection, citing 2 Samuel 7:1-10.
He advised the members to apply the 3P's in their daily prayers, so that God would replace whatever they lost in 2025, replant new ideas for 2026 and grant them protection in their daily activities.
Lt Cdr Amegashie also emphasized the importance of patience and trusting God's perfect timing, encouraging them to be open to God's direction, which often differs from their own ideas.
The President of the Army Wives Association and wife of the Chief of the Army Staff, Mrs. Patience Dzifa Adeti-Gbetanu, commended the Chief Staff Officer at the Army Headquarters, Brigadier General Lloyd Atror, the Commanding Officer at Army Headquarters, Lieutenant Colonel Solomon Fiifi Ewudzie, the officiating ministers, the wives, and everyone who attended the annual service.
The ceremony, led by Reverend Nii Okai and his team, was filled with hymns, worship and praises.
